Six chief education secretary positions vacant

11 Dec 2014

There are six vacant chief education secretary positions in six councils countrywide, according to the Assistant Minister of Local Government and Rural Development, Ms Botlogile Tshireletso.

Ms Tshireletso said the positions were at Kgalagadi, Kgatleng, Ghanzi, North West, North East and Kweneng District councils. The positions remained vacant due to transfer resistance and protracted appeals by staff that was transferred to fill the said positions, she added.

Responding to a question in Parliament, she said the transfers were eventually withdrawn and the positions re-advertised and the ministry is however finalising recruitment into chief education secretary positions and others.

The MP for Ramotswa, Mr Samuel Rantuana had asked the minister to state the number of posts of chief education secretary which are vacant countrywide and to say in which councils; he had also wanted to know when such posts fell vacant and why they have not been filled. ENDS
